Often called the 'green lungs of the city', Can Gio Mangrove Forest is a wetland biosphere about 40 kms from Ho Chi Minh City. The forest features more than 150 species of flora and fauna, and tourists can explore the swamps to catch a sight of the monkeys, crustaceans and fish there. There is also a restaurant and a swimming pool to refresh visitors.
Located in the coastal district of the southeastern part of Ho Chi Minh City, Can Gio Mangrove Forest is an initiative aimed at environmental conservation and preservation of natural habitats of various species of flora and fauna. With the meeting of Dong Nai and Saigon rivers, the swamp soil has given origin to mangrove forest that has the largest number of mangrove plants, mangrove-dwelling fishes and other creatures in the region. Can Gio is spread across an area of 75,740 hectares that houses more than 150 botanical species and over 200 animal species.
